Check the plugs for fouling, check the distributor cap + rotor + wires too. Also check the ignition coil for any cracking or anything wrong.
Could also be the upstream O2 sensor. Unless the cat is clogged, I doubt it is causing an issue on your 87 - only the upstream o2 sensor affects engine tuning
